Numbers Overview: The book of Numbers tells the story of Israel's repeated rebellion in the wilderness and how it is met by God's justice and mercy. God responds with short-term severity and long-term generosity that speaks to his covenant faithfulness. Rev. Jesse Lund • Overview Videos

Joshua Overview: The book of Joshua shows us God's covenant faithfulness to bring the Israelites into the land he promised Abraham. This book points to the importance of covenant obedience before, during, and after God fulfills his promises. Rev. Jesse Lund • Overview Videos
